programming-languages - F35 Lightning II飞机使用的主要编程语言是什么?

标签 programming-languages embedded

我知道F22使用了ADA。 F35上软件的主要语言是什么?

最佳答案

F-35联合打击战斗机(闪电II)软件由以下语言组成(至少根据下面的消息来源):

enter image description here

Source | Source - Alt(第38页)

由此可见:


7%组装
5%Ada 83,
35%的C ++,以及
53%C。


我认为Wikipedia的声明有些不正确。 F-35的所有新开发都使用C或C ++完成。根据以上来源:


在几乎每种情况下,都做出了使用C或C ++的相同决定,只是从以前的(F-22)开发中可以进行大量重用的情况除外。


编辑2016-03-10:主要来源已死,我还没有找到新来源。

关于programming-languages - F35 Lightning II飞机使用的主要编程语言是什么?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9827176/

相关文章:

linux - 如何摆脱 libthread_db

c - 新的类 C 语言支持 - Eclipse Xtext 与 Eclipse CDT 与 Netbeans(JavaCC,...)

java - 将一个长字符串读入内存

programming-languages - try/catch/finally 语法的起源

programming-languages - 创建语言解释器

linux - 为什么在 omap 器件的 TI x-loader makefile 中使用 $$PWD 而不是 $PWD

c# - 为什么在任何编程语言中都有声明默认 namespace /库的约定?

将函数复制到 RAM

assembly - 为什么在从引导加载程序跳转到应用程序之前需要更新堆栈指针

c - 嵌入式系统的对称加密算法